This video from Guns Pinoy addresses what to do if you fail the neuropsychiatric exam required for a License to Own and Possess Firearm (LTOP) in the Philippines. The speaker emphasizes that failing the exam, especially on the first try, is not necessarily the end of one's pursuit of responsible gun ownership. It's possible to retake the exam after six months, and the speaker offers tips for preparation, focusing on understanding the exam's purpose beyond just intelligence, and maintaining a calm, consistent approach.
This video provides a detailed overview of Australia's complex firearm ownership laws, contrasting them with potential US legislation. It explains the multi-tiered licensing system (Categories A, B, C, D), the strict storage requirements, the absence of concealed carry and self-defense laws, and the significant costs associated with gun ownership, including club memberships and permit fees. The discussion highlights how registration is seen as a precursor to confiscation and the impact of state-level variations on firearm legality.
